Dennos Closed Until September

By Luke Haase | May 3, 2017

The Dennos Museum Center closed to the public Monday and will remain closed until approximately mid-June in order to accommodate construction.

The museum at Northwestern Michigan College is undergoing an almost 15,000 square-foot expansion adding permanent collections galleries on the museum side and a multi-purpose room and revamped loading dock to Milliken Auditorium. The expansion is the result of several significant local donations, including $1 million from Barbara and Dudley Smith III and $2 million from Diana and Richard Milock.

"We look forward to these expanded opportunities that enhance our mission to engage, enlighten and entertain our audiences through the collection of art, and the presentation of exhibitions and programs in the visual arts, sciences and performing arts," the Dennos said in a statement Monday.

The public will still be able to access the museum for previously scheduled events. Questions and ticket purchases will still be accommodated during regular business hours Monday-Friday at 231-995-1055.
